Notes on using the input selector buttons
●
Note that pressing each input selector button selects the
source which is connected to the corresponding input
terminals on the rear panel.
●
The selection of TAPE/MD MONITOR cannot be canceled
by pressing another input selector button. To cancel it,
press TAPE/MD MONITOR again so that the “TAPE
MONITOR” indicator disappears from the display.
When you select a button other than TAPE/MD
MONITOR, make sure that the “TAPE MONITOR”
indicator is not illuminated on the display.
●
If you select the input selector button for a video source
without canceling the selection of TAPE/MD MONITOR,
the playback result will be the video image from the video
source and the sound from the audio tape (or MD etc.).
●
Once you play a video source, its video image will not be
interrupted even if the input selector button for an audio
source is selected.
When you finish using this unit
Press the STANDBY/ON switch on the front panel again or
the POWER /I key on the remote control transmitter to turn
this unit into the standby mode.
